Draw for last eight made, with Newcastle paired with holders City

The Magpies beat West Bromwich Albion 3-2 at The Hawthorns on Tuesday night to reach the last eight of the competition for the first time since 2006.

And they will face City - who won 1-0 at Sheffield Wednesday - after the draw was made by former Magpies winger Chris Waddle and ex-Arsenal defender Martin Keown at Hillsborough on Wednesday evening.

Pep Guardiola's side won 6-0 against Watford in last year's final at Wembley to lift the trophy. Newcastle and City have already met in the league at St. James' Park - a thrilling 2-2 draw in November.

Quarter-final ties will be played between Friday, 20th March and Sunday, 22nd March, meaning United's Premier League home game against Aston Villa on Saturday, 21st March will be rescheduled.

It also means the Premier League match between City and the Magpies at the Etihad Stadium on Saturday, 18th April will be postponed due to one of the sides now being guaranteed a place in the semi-finals.

New dates for those fixtures, and ticket details for the FA Cup quarter-final, will be announced on nufc.co.uk in due course.
